Mark Kelly, a former astronaut and husband of former Rep. Gabrielle Giffords, was sworn in as a U.S. senator on Wednesday afternoon.Kelly, a Democrat, defeated Sen. Martha McSally in a November special election. McSally had been appointed by Gov. Doug Ducey to serve in the seat once occupied by Sen. John McCain, who died in 2018.Because Kelly was elected in a special election, he is being sworn in ahead of newly-elected Senators, who will assume their roles early next year.Kelly's seat is one of three Democrats flipped on election day, while Republicans were able to flip one seat back into their control. Control of the chamber remains dependant on the outcome of two runoff elections in Georgia, which will take place in January.During his NASA career, Kelly flew four missions to space and totaled more than 54 days outside of the Earth's atmosphere. His twin brother, Scott, is also an astronaut.Kelly's first foray into politics came via his wife. Giffords was first elected as a congresswoman in 2006, but in 2011, a gunman shot her in the head during an assassination attempt. She survived the shooting but resigned her seat in early 2012 to focus on the recovery.Kelly is at least the second former astronaut to serve in the U.S. Senate, following in the footsteps of John Glenn, who was the first man to orbit the earth and served as a senator representing Ohio from 1974 to 1999. 1403

MEXICO CITY (AP) — Mexico's office for environmental protection says it has filed a criminal complaint against the organizers of the Score Baja 1000 off-road race for damaging protected desert areas.The office said Thursday that some participants in the Nov. 14-18 race departed from agreed-on routes and damaged cactuses and other desert plants in the Valle de los Cirios protected area. Inspectors found damaged choya, agave and cardon plants.Score International spokesman Juan Tintos Funcke says the Reno, Nevada-based company has not received any formal notification from Mexican authorities. Tintos Funcke's statement adds that "as soon as we do we will coordinate ourselves with them in order to attend to it."The race starts from Ensenada in Baja California state. 779

  

McClatchy, the publisher of more than two dozen daily newspapers across the country, will reduce its staff by approximately three and a half percent, cut expenses across the company, and implement other measures to save money, the company announced in an internal memo obtained by CNN on Tuesday.Craig Forman, president and chief executive officer of McClatchy, told employees in the memo that the decisions were "painful and difficult" but "necessary to protect and further our future." He placed blame, in part, on the decline in revenue from print advertising."Talented and passionate people who have dedicated their energy to our mission, colleagues we call friends and rely on everyday, will leave the company," Forman wrote. "We thank you all for your commitment to McClatchy and to local journalism and wish you nothing but the best in your future endeavors."A spokesperson for the company told CNN that the staff reductions would affect nearly 140 employees.Forman said that the employees impacted have been notified. He also said other measures were being taken to reduce operating costs, including cutting expenses across the company and having senior leaders take two weeks of unpaid leave.Forman, however, said that "most of our expense savings are in legacy areas" which would allow the company to "continue to build our future as a digital-DNA, journalism-driven media business."Among the newspapers McClatchy operates are the Miami Herald, Sacramento Bee, Lexington Herald-Leader, The Charlotte Observer, The Herald-Sun, The Wichita Eagle, and The Kansas City Star.The cuts come at a time when local newspapers continue to struggle. The New York Daily News slashed 50 percent of its newsroom in July. 1728

  

LUTZ, Fla. — A South Carolina man was arrested in Florida after Hillsborough County deputies say he planned to commit a crime he planned for eight months.The Hillsborough County Sheriff's Office said on Sunday, August 16 at 2:43 a.m., the suspect, Phillip Thomas, 24, entered a home within the Promenade at Lake Park in Lutz.Detectives learned Thomas parked his car at Idle Wild Church earlier that night, walked to the home, cut a hole in the patio screen, and remained there for about three to four hours. He was watching and listening through the windows, officials said.After the homeowner went to bed, Thomas came in through the back sliding door which activated the home alarm. It prompted the homeowner to look out the window and spot Thomas.The homeowner and a guest left the home in a car and called 911.When deputies arrived, Thomas was still inside the home.According to public records, the home is owned by Daria Berenato. She is a WWE wrestler who goes by the name Sonya Deville. “I have spoken to her and I’m glad she’s safe and I’m thankful and grateful that the sheriff's office took care of the situation immediately. Celebrity status aside this is sickening. I am a product of a sexual assault and have zero-tolerance or respect for any human being that would violate a person's privacy and or personal space," said WWE Superstar Titus O'Neil.Deputies discovered he was carrying a knife, plastic zip ties, duct tape, mace, and other items.Through the investigation, detectives discovered Thomas lived in South Carolina and came to Lutz specifically targeting the homeowner."We know the suspect was completely obsessed with the victim and they had been trying to engage in a conversation for several years, but were unsuccessful, and then Sunday night is when they tried to confront the victim," said Natalia Verdina, a public information officer with HCSO.Thomas told deputies he was planning to take the homeowner hostage."Our deputies are unveiling the suspect's disturbing obsession with this homeowner who he had never met, but stalked on social media for years," said Sheriff Chad Chronister. "It's frightening to think of all the ways this incident could have played out had the home alarm not gone off and alerted the homeowner of an intruder. Our deputies arrived within minutes and arrested this man who was clearly on a mission to inflict harm."Thomas was charged with aggravated stalking, armed burglary of a dwelling, attempted armed kidnapping, and criminal mischief.We spoke with cybersecurity expert Stu Sjouwerman. He's the founder of KnowBe4, which trains business and individuals to be safer online. We asked him how easy it is to find the personal information of regular people and celebrities. His answer was the same for both."It is horribly easy. You would be surprised," he said.Sjouwerman says there's no clear way to guarantee the protection of your data in today's age with one exception.“Take a pair of scissors and snip that wire, go offline, and off-grid altogether.
